本文目錄導讀:
CSS實現(xiàn)文本截取技巧
在網(wǎng)頁設計中,我們經常需要處理文本顯示的問題,其中之一就是如何只展示文本的前幾位字符,這可以通過CSS的文本溢出(overflow)和文本寬度(text-width)屬性來實現(xiàn),下面,我們將詳細介紹如何使用這些CSS屬性來截取文本的前幾位字符。
CSS文本溢出屬性
超過其包含元素的大小時,我們可以使用CSS的溢出屬性來處理,overflow屬性可以定義當內容溢出元素框時發(fā)生的事情,對于截取文本的前幾位字符,我們主要使用overflow的隱藏值(hidden),這樣超出部分的內容將被隱藏。
CSS文本寬度屬性
我們需要使用text-width屬性來限制文本的寬度,這個屬性可以限制在一個塊級元素中的行內文本寬度,當文本超出這個寬度時,多余的內容將被隱藏,我們可以根據(jù)需要設定具體的寬度值。
結合使用實現(xiàn)文本截取
將上述兩個屬性結合使用,我們可以實現(xiàn)文本的截取,設置一個固定的文本寬度,使用overflow: hidden來隱藏超出部分的內容,這樣,我們就可以只顯示文本的前幾位字符了。
注意事項
需要注意的是,這種方法只適用于單行文本的截取,對于多行文本,可能需要額外的處理,比如使用文本省略(text-overflow: ellipsis)來顯示省略號,表示還有更多內容,這種方法對于中文和英文等不同的語言可能需要不同的處理方式,因為不同語言的字符寬度可能會有所不同。
通過CSS的溢出屬性和文本寬度屬性,我們可以方便地實現(xiàn)文本的截取,只展示文本的前幾位字符,這種方法簡單易用,適用于大多數(shù)情況。